Job Description AdMedia India is seeking an experienced Linux System Administrator/DevOps who is passionate about infrastructure design to join its Platform Operations team. We leverage our infrastructure with heavy automation for server deployment and provisioning. This is an ideal opportunity for someone who enjoys experimenting and thoughtfully architect systems!
Work Location : Anywhere in India (Remote)
Work Timing : 4 PM to 12 AM IST (Evening Shift)
Working Days : 5 Days a week (Monday to Friday)
Responsibilities
- Design and implement infrastructure and automation improvements.
- Provision and manage servers and environments.
- Develop and maintain configuration management templates.
- Monitor and optimize system performance; respond to incidents.
- Participate in on-call rotation and production support.
- Support development and QA teams during software releases and patches.
- Ensure compliance with security standards and best practices.
- Manage user access and security policies.
- Safeguard application data against loss, theft, or disasters.
- Partner with external services for seamless integrations.
- Stay up to date with emerging technologies to improve systems and processes; continually push the company and the team to leverage the best possible tools and resources.
Required Experience And Qualifications
- 5+ years of Linux Administration experience.
- Proficiency in at least one scripting language (Python, Ruby, PHP, or Bash).
- Strong knowledge of TCP/IP, HTTP, ICMP, and other network protocols.
- Experience with web servers (Apache, Nginx, or Tomcat).
- Hands-on with caching technologies (Redis, Memcached).
- Monitoring and observability using Prometheus & Grafana.
- Configuration management and automation with Ansible.
- Virtualization (KVM, XEN, VMware, AWS) and cloud expertise (AWS & Oracle Cloud Infrastructure).
- Database administration : MySQL, NoSQL (e.g., MongoDB), Sphinx/Manticore search engines.
- Experience managing Node.js applications and Elasticsearch clusters.
- Proficiency with collaboration and DevOps tools: Jira, Bitbucket, Git.
- Experience with Google Workspace administration.
- Familiarity with SSL certificate management, DNS configuration, and Domain management.
- Bachelors degree in Computer Science (or equivalent experience).
